Why Flower Still Leads the Cannabis Experience

Flower is the most recognizable and time-honored form of cannabis, and for good reason. It is the dried, cured bud of the cannabis plant—the part that holds the aromatic compounds, cannabinoids, and terpenes that define each strain’s character. When you choose flower, you are choosing the plant in one of its most direct forms, with minimal processing between harvest and your hands. Common Questions People Ask at the Bud Bar

When customers step up to our bud bar and start exploring flower, a handful of questions come up again and again. We want you to feel comfortable asking any of them, because understanding what you are buying is a core part of cannabis safety and education—something we are genuinely committed to at Altalune Dispensary. Here are the questions we hear most, along with the kind of guidance we share.

  • What does indica, sativa, and hybrid actually mean? These traditional categories offer a general starting point. Indica-leaning strains are often associated with relaxation and evening use, sativa-leaning strains with energy and daytime activity, and hybrids blend characteristics of both. That said, individual response varies, and terpene profiles often tell a richer story than the category alone.
  • How strong is this flower? Potency is usually measured by THC and CBD percentages printed on the label. A higher THC percentage does not automatically mean a better experience—it means a more intense one. For newcomers, we frequently suggest starting with a moderate potency and adjusting from there.
  • How should I store my flower? Keep it in an airtight container away from light, heat, and excess moisture. Proper storage preserves both the aroma and the potency, so your flower stays fresh from your first session to your last.
  • How much should I buy? That depends on how often you plan to use it. Flower stays best when consumed within a reasonable window, so buying an amount you will finish while it is fresh is usually the smart move.

Understanding the Technical Side of Flower

For those who want to dig deeper, the details on a flower label carry real meaning. Cannabinoid content, expressed as a percentage, tells you the concentration of compounds like THC and CBD. Terpene content, when listed, hints at aroma, flavor, and the subtle differences in how a strain may feel. The harvest and packaging dates matter too, because flower is at its best when relatively fresh—older flower can lose aromatic complexity and become harsher to enjoy.

Cultivation methods shape the final product in significant ways. Careful curing, for example, allows chlorophyll to break down and moisture to balance, which smooths the smoke and preserves flavor. A well-grown, well-cured bud will feel slightly sticky, break apart without crumbling to dust, and carry a vivid, layered aroma. The way you choose to enjoy flower also affects your experience. Rolling it, packing a bowl, or using a dry-herb vaporizer each produce slightly different results in flavor and intensity. A vaporizer, for instance, tends to preserve terpene nuance and can be gentler on the throat, while traditional combustion offers the familiar ritual many people love.
